Abstract (en)
This work presents the numerical analysis of the influence of the Kerr nonlinearity of the quadratically-nonlinear medium and the degree of the super-Gaussian distribution of the FF pulses to the duration, shape and the propagation factor of the FF pulses compressed to the maximum due to the cascaded nonlinearity and the group velocity dispersion. It was determined that a pulse with the initial duration of 120 fs and the initial Gaussian radial distribution is compressed almost twice, and it shortens at the beam center to almost 20 fs, and its propagation factor increases to 1.7-1.8.
